No.
1. Though this is Linux group, we also talk about
other FOSS.
   I dont think that anyone would object to me/anyone
asking a question of installation problem of, say...
MySQL on FreeBSD.
   Similarly we should know the various FOSS
alternatives available on other OSs too.

2. If I want to move from some OS (Windows/mac
anything) to linux, as an end user I 1st will always
try to know which applications are present in both the
systems/OSs. Then convert my data from say MS office
to OOO format. And after being comfortable with OOO on
windows/other OS, transfer the data to linux.
   Also, even if I do not plan to start using linux
and am currently using windows, I definitly would be
interested in applications which will make my data
transfer across OSs very easy.
